Output 34fc2f84c77d699f26cd6b4fc3042c58ab03cad6b1d051a141345856508984e1:1

value
12619564
script pubkey
OP_0 OP_PUSHBYTES_20 26d08416b4ef10dcb00fdda986023946d1875fbd
address
bc1qymggg945augdevq0mk5cvq3egmgcwhaarhq0x5
transaction
34fc2f84c77d699f26cd6b4fc3042c58ab03cad6b1d051a141345856508984e1
spent
true